    Growing up in rural Kansas, Parks was told by his teachers that going to college was out of the question for any black kid. Many years later, this 20th century Renaissance man received honorary degrees from many universities in recognition of his artistic achievements. Parks started off as a fashion photographer, or rather fell into the job. He would go on to photograph subjects ranging from movie stars to street people.

    Parks' American Gothic, the one of the cleaning woman, taken at the Lincoln Memorial, is arguably his most famous photo.

    I wanted to post a portrait he did of his uncle, but all the images I could find were too bit to post here. The interesting thing about that photo is the flow of movement. No matter what you look at, your eyes always move back to the uncle's hand.

    Parks also wrote books, and directed a few movies. I recommend watching The Learning Tree.

    I hope some day to visit the Gordon Parks Museum located in his hometown of Fort Scott, Kansas.
